ANAVEM
Reference
Languagefr
Digital security visualization representing TLS encrypted data transmission
ExplainedTLS

What is TLS? Definition, How It Works & Use Cases

TLS (Transport Layer Security) encrypts data in transit between clients and servers. Learn how TLS works, its evolution from SSL, and security best practices.

Emanuel DE ALMEIDAEmanuel DE ALMEIDA
16 March 2026 9 min 6
TLSSecurity 9 min
Introduction

Overview

You're entering your credit card details on an e-commerce website when you notice the padlock icon in your browser's address bar. That small symbol represents one of the internet's most critical security protocols working behind the scenes. Transport Layer Security (TLS) is silently protecting billions of online transactions, emails, and communications every day, yet most users never think about the complex cryptographic dance happening with every HTTPS connection.

In 2026, with cyber threats evolving rapidly and data breaches making headlines weekly, understanding TLS has become essential for anyone working in IT, web development, or cybersecurity. Whether you're configuring web servers, implementing APIs, or simply want to understand how your online banking stays secure, TLS knowledge is no longer optional—it's fundamental to modern digital infrastructure.

What is TLS?

Transport Layer Security (TLS) is a cryptographic protocol that provides secure communication over computer networks, most commonly the internet. TLS encrypts data transmitted between clients (like web browsers) and servers, ensuring that sensitive information remains confidential and tamper-proof during transit.

Think of TLS as a secure envelope system for digital communication. When you send a physical letter containing sensitive information, you might use a locked briefcase handed directly to a trusted courier. TLS works similarly—it wraps your digital data in multiple layers of encryption, verifies the identity of both sender and receiver, and ensures the message arrives unchanged. Just as the locked briefcase prevents unauthorized access during transport, TLS prevents eavesdropping, tampering, and impersonation in digital communications.

Related: What is PKI? Definition, How It Works & Use Cases

Related: What is a Firewall?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is SOC? Definition, How It Works & Use Cases

Related: What is Cybersecurity?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is PKI? Definition, How It Works & Use Cases

Related: What is a Firewall?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is Zero-Day? Definition, How It Works & Use Cases

Related: What is SOC?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is PKI? Definition, How It Works & Use Cases

Related: What is a Firewall?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is Zero-Day? Definition, How It Works & Use Cases

Related: What is SOC?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is PKI? Definition, How It Works & Use Cases

Related: What is a Firewall?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is Zero-Day? Definition, How It Works & Use Cases

Related: What is SOC?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is PKI? Definition, How It Works & Use Cases

Related: What is a Firewall?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is Zero-Day? Definition, How It Works & Use Cases

Related: What is SOC?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is PKI? Definition, How It Works & Use Cases

Related: What is a Firewall?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is SOC? Definition, How It Works & Use Cases

Related: What is SIEM?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is SIEM? Definition, How It Works & Use Cases

Related: What is PKI?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is a Firewall? Definition, How It Works & Use Cases

Related: What is Cybersecurity?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is PKI? Definition, How It Works & Use Cases

Related: What is a Firewall?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is Zero-Day? Definition, How It Works & Use Cases

Related: What is DDoS?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

Related: What is Encryption? Definition, How It Works & Use Cases

Related: What is SSL Certificate? Definition, How It Works & Use

Related: What is a Firewall? Definition, How It Works & Use Cases

Related: What is Cybersecurity? Definition, How It Works & Use Cases

Related: What is PKI? Definition, How It Works & Use Cases

Related: What is Ransomware? Definition, How It Works & Prevention

TLS is the successor to Secure Sockets Layer (SSL), though the terms are often used interchangeably in casual conversation. The protocol operates at the transport layer of the network stack, sitting between the application layer (HTTP, SMTP, FTP) and the network layer (TCP), making it transparent to applications while providing robust security.

How does TLS work?

TLS establishes secure connections through a sophisticated handshake process that combines symmetric and asymmetric encryption, digital certificates, and cryptographic hashing. The process involves several critical steps that happen automatically within milliseconds.

The TLS Handshake Process:

  1. Client Hello: The client initiates the connection by sending a "Client Hello" message containing supported TLS versions, cipher suites, and a random number for session uniqueness.
  2. Server Hello: The server responds with its chosen TLS version, selected cipher suite, its own random number, and presents its digital certificate containing the public key.
  3. Certificate Verification: The client validates the server's certificate against trusted Certificate Authorities (CAs) to ensure authenticity and prevent man-in-the-middle attacks.
  4. Key Exchange: Both parties generate a shared secret key using methods like RSA, Elliptic Curve Diffie-Hellman (ECDH), or other key exchange algorithms.
  5. Session Key Generation: Using the exchanged information and random numbers, both client and server independently generate identical symmetric encryption keys.
  6. Handshake Completion: Both parties send "Finished" messages encrypted with the new session keys to confirm successful establishment.

Once the handshake completes, all subsequent communication uses symmetric encryption with the established session keys, providing both speed and security. The symmetric keys are periodically refreshed to maintain security over long-lived connections.

Note: Modern TLS implementations use Perfect Forward Secrecy (PFS), ensuring that even if long-term keys are compromised, past communications remain secure.

What is TLS used for?

TLS secures a vast array of internet communications and applications across virtually every industry and use case where data protection matters.

Web Browsing and HTTPS

The most visible use of TLS is in HTTPS connections, where it protects everything from online banking and shopping to social media interactions. Every time you see "https://" in a URL, TLS is encrypting the communication between your browser and the web server, protecting login credentials, personal information, and browsing activity from interception.

Email Security

TLS secures email transmission through protocols like SMTP over TLS (SMTPS), IMAP over TLS (IMAPS), and POP3 over TLS (POP3S). This prevents email interception during transit, though it doesn't encrypt stored emails unless additional encryption is applied. Major email providers like Gmail, Outlook, and Yahoo rely heavily on TLS for protecting billions of daily email transmissions.

API Communications

Modern applications depend on API calls between services, mobile apps, and third-party integrations. TLS ensures these communications remain secure, protecting API keys, user data, and business logic from exposure. RESTful APIs, GraphQL endpoints, and microservice architectures all rely on TLS for secure inter-service communication.

VPN and Remote Access

Many VPN solutions use TLS as their underlying security protocol, creating encrypted tunnels for remote workers accessing corporate networks. TLS-based VPNs offer advantages in firewall traversal and can leverage existing PKI infrastructure, making them popular in enterprise environments.

IoT and Device Communications

Internet of Things devices increasingly use TLS to secure communications with cloud services, mobile apps, and other devices. From smart home systems to industrial sensors, TLS protects device data and prevents unauthorized access to connected systems.

Advantages and disadvantages of TLS

Advantages:

  • Strong Security: TLS provides robust encryption, authentication, and integrity protection using industry-standard cryptographic algorithms
  • Wide Compatibility: Supported by virtually all modern browsers, servers, and applications, ensuring universal interoperability
  • Transparent Implementation: Applications can use TLS without significant code changes, as it operates at the transport layer
  • Certificate-Based Trust: PKI infrastructure provides scalable identity verification through trusted Certificate Authorities
  • Performance Optimization: Modern TLS versions include features like session resumption and connection multiplexing to minimize overhead
  • Regulatory Compliance: Helps organizations meet data protection requirements like GDPR, HIPAA, and PCI DSS

Disadvantages:

  • Computational Overhead: Encryption and decryption processes consume CPU resources, though modern hardware minimizes this impact
  • Certificate Management Complexity: Requires ongoing certificate lifecycle management, including renewal, revocation, and key rotation
  • Initial Handshake Latency: The TLS handshake adds round-trip delays, particularly noticeable on high-latency connections
  • Certificate Costs: While free certificates exist, enterprise-grade certificates and management solutions can be expensive
  • Configuration Complexity: Proper TLS configuration requires understanding of cipher suites, protocol versions, and security best practices
  • Trust Dependencies: Security relies on the integrity of Certificate Authorities, creating potential single points of failure

TLS vs SSL

While TLS and SSL are often mentioned together, understanding their relationship and differences is crucial for IT professionals working with secure communications.

AspectSSL (Secure Sockets Layer)TLS (Transport Layer Security)
Current StatusDeprecated (SSL 3.0 retired in 2015)Active standard (TLS 1.3 current as of 2026)
SecurityKnown vulnerabilities (POODLE, BEAST)Continuously improved security features
PerformanceSlower handshake processOptimized handshake, session resumption
Cipher SuitesLimited, some now considered weakModern, regularly updated algorithms
Perfect Forward SecrecyNot supportedStandard feature in TLS 1.2+
Industry SupportLegacy systems onlyUniversal support across platforms

Despite SSL being technically obsolete, the term "SSL certificate" persists in common usage, even when referring to certificates used with TLS. This linguistic legacy often confuses newcomers, but in practice, any reference to "SSL" in modern contexts almost certainly means TLS.

Warning: Organizations still using SSL 3.0 or earlier face serious security risks and should immediately upgrade to TLS 1.2 or higher.

Best practices with TLS

  1. Use TLS 1.2 or Higher: Disable older protocol versions including SSL 3.0, TLS 1.0, and TLS 1.1. TLS 1.3, finalized in 2018, offers the best security and performance. Configure servers to prefer the highest available version while maintaining compatibility with legitimate clients.
  2. Implement Strong Cipher Suites: Configure servers to use only strong, modern cipher suites that support Perfect Forward Secrecy. Disable weak algorithms like RC4, DES, and export-grade ciphers. Regularly review and update cipher suite configurations as cryptographic standards evolve.
  3. Maintain Certificate Hygiene: Use certificates from reputable Certificate Authorities, implement automated certificate renewal to prevent expiration, and maintain proper certificate chain configuration. Consider Certificate Transparency monitoring to detect unauthorized certificates for your domains.
  4. Enable HTTP Strict Transport Security (HSTS): Implement HSTS headers to force browsers to use HTTPS connections and prevent protocol downgrade attacks. Include subdomains in HSTS policies and consider HSTS preloading for critical domains.
  5. Regular Security Assessments: Conduct periodic TLS configuration audits using tools like SSL Labs' SSL Test or similar scanners. Monitor for new vulnerabilities and apply security patches promptly. Test configurations against common attacks like BEAST, CRIME, and POODLE.
  6. Implement Certificate Pinning: For high-security applications, implement certificate or public key pinning to prevent man-in-the-middle attacks using rogue certificates. Balance security benefits against operational complexity and certificate rotation requirements.
Tip: Use automated tools like Certbot for Let's Encrypt certificates to simplify certificate management and ensure timely renewals.

Transport Layer Security has evolved from a nice-to-have security feature to an essential component of modern internet infrastructure. As we move further into 2026, with quantum computing threats on the horizon and privacy regulations becoming stricter worldwide, TLS continues adapting to meet new challenges. The protocol's success lies in its balance of strong security, broad compatibility, and relative ease of implementation.

For IT professionals, mastering TLS configuration and management is no longer optional—it's a core competency. Whether you're securing web applications, API endpoints, or IoT communications, understanding TLS principles and best practices will serve you well in building resilient, secure systems. As post-quantum cryptography standards emerge and TLS continues evolving, staying current with TLS developments will remain crucial for maintaining robust cybersecurity postures.

Frequently Asked Questions

What is TLS in simple terms?+
TLS (Transport Layer Security) is a security protocol that encrypts data sent between your device and websites or servers. It's what makes the padlock appear in your browser when you visit secure websites, protecting your passwords, credit card details, and other sensitive information from hackers.
What is TLS used for?+
TLS is primarily used to secure web browsing (HTTPS), email transmission, API communications, VPN connections, and IoT device communications. Any time you need to protect data traveling over the internet, TLS provides the encryption and authentication needed to keep it safe.
Is TLS the same as SSL?+
No, TLS is the modern successor to SSL (Secure Sockets Layer). SSL is now deprecated due to security vulnerabilities, while TLS continues to be actively developed and improved. However, people often use the terms interchangeably, and "SSL certificates" actually work with TLS protocols.
How do I enable TLS on my website?+
To enable TLS, you need to obtain an SSL/TLS certificate from a Certificate Authority, configure your web server to use HTTPS, and ensure your server supports modern TLS versions (1.2 or higher). Many hosting providers offer automated certificate installation, and free certificates are available through Let's Encrypt.
What happens if TLS fails or is misconfigured?+
TLS failures can result in connection errors, browser security warnings, or worse—unencrypted data transmission. Misconfigurations might allow attackers to intercept sensitive information, perform man-in-the-middle attacks, or exploit weak encryption. Regular security audits and proper configuration are essential to prevent these issues.
References

Official Resources (3)

Emanuel DE ALMEIDA
Written by

Emanuel DE ALMEIDA

Microsoft MCSA-certified Cloud Architect | Fortinet-focused. I modernize cloud, hybrid & on-prem infrastructure for reliability, security, performance and cost control - sharing field-tested ops & troubleshooting.

Discussion

Share your thoughts and insights

You must be logged in to comment.

Loading comments...